Deception

AshleyBerkelmans

Beneath those heavy eyelids
Is a girl who fears the stage

Youth will now be stolen
Her decisions ready made

How hard you've work to be here
Now the lights they seem so cold

It's a shame you had potential
But your contracts signed in blood

When we see you on tv
We'll know exactly who you are

Just another star that time forgot
Who could have been much more

Your piercing eyes and jet black hair
Fade out to gentle greys

You're favourite colour's red
But the public know it's green

How sad to see the world go by
Freewill you'll never claim

It's so hard to see that empty smile

All I see is the curve of your distain
